    Whirpool Gold with Senseon Dryer failing to heat
    This Whirlpool Gold Senseon Dryer was manufactured in 1998. Sometimes the heat fails to come on and the dryer continues to run without drying. I have check that the vent is clear, the lint screen is clear, the drum motor runs fine and the ventilation fan runs fine. I've opened up the unit to clear any obstructions in fan and found some long lost items.

    The funny thing is when I turn off the breaker or unplugged the unit and then turn it back on, the heating function is restored. The dryer runs fine for a few weeks and then stops drying again.

    GEX9868JQ0

    Does anyone have any ideas for an inexpensive fix?
